作者: ³ú¼é¶Ó   German IRIS T arrived today. Norwegian NASAMS next month 2022-10-11 16:52:18  [点击:838]


It is unlikely that this newly arrived German air defense system has played a role in today's defense. It will take a while to install, train and then operate. It is notable that this version of IRIS T (IRIS-T SLM) has not even actively served in the German military themselves.

I tend to think that the increase in interception precision comes more from the decreasing Russian cruise missile quality than from the Ukrainian interception's tech improvement. It is unlikely that the learning process on the Ukrainian side improved this fast in a day.

It seems that most of what Kremlin has left are subsonic snail-pace cruise missiles. NATO can basically calculate the trajectory real-time, send the data to the Ukrainian anti-missile troops, and literally have Ukrainian infantry soldiers using portable missiles (Soviet 9K38 or NATO stinger, both dirt-cheap toys as compared with their cruise missile targets) to shoot them down as one of many interception methods.

Normally, anti-missile defense will be far more expensive than the missile-base offensive moves. But here we do see those rare counter-examples: a decade-old 9K38, costing $30K something, knocks out this million-dollar-baby called cruise missile.
